Enhancing Visitor Engagement with Directional Sounds
The implementation of directional sounds has transformed the way UK curators and exhibition designers think about the visitor journey. In a traditional gallery or museum, the "acoustic overlap" from different video screens and audio guides often creates a confusing wall of noise. By utilizing technology that produces directional sounds, it is possible to isolate specific audio content to a single exhibit. This allows visitors to move through a space and experience a seamless transition between different audio "worlds," ensuring that each story is heard clearly without the distraction of neighboring displays.
The Science of Sonic Isolation
The technology behind these focused experiences involves sophisticated wave-shaping. Unlike standard loudspeakers that broadcast sound in a wide radius, emitters designed for directional sounds behave more like spotlights.
By utilizing ultrasonic transducers or phased-array processing, these systems project audio in a tight column. This ensures that the narration or soundscape is only audible to the person standing directly in the "sweet spot," maintaining a respectful silence throughout the rest of the venue.
Applications in Experiential Retail
In the retail sector, directional sounds are used to create "sensory pockets" that draw customers toward specific products. For example, a luxury car showroom might use focused audio to play the sound of an engine only when a customer is standing next to a specific vehicle. This creates a highly personal, immersive experience that increases engagement without contributing to the overall noise floor of the store.
FAQs
How narrow is the sound beam? Most professional systems can create a beam as narrow as 15 to 20 degrees.
Can visitors hear it from the side? Very little. The sound level drops off significantly as soon as you step outside the intended path.
